Quarterly Planning Note — Vexhall Licensing Dispute

The disagreement with Vexhall Instruments over the Corvid toolkit licence remains unresolved. Counsel advises our usage falls within the original grant, but renewal terms are contested. We have budgeted for either a negotiated settlement or a migration to the in-house alternative by year-end. Engineering has scoped the migration at eleven weeks. The board should note the contingency position described below.

confidential, kagup-bafog: Fraaxax Group is in early talks to buy Soroxox Group for about $343.8 million. The Olidor launch date is June 14, and nothing goes to the press before then. Legal wants the Aldmirek Logistics term sheet signed before July 23.

Subject: Fleet fuel report — fix shipped

Support team: the Haulmark fuel-usage report no longer double-counts refuels logged within the same hour. Hotfix is live in all regions. Customers asking about inflated totals from last week should re-run the report; historical data was backfilled overnight. No action needed for reports generated after today. When escalating anything related, quote the build shown below.

build token for yajof-bajof: htk31_506ff1188f74596b5bb2eec94edc43c

Ticket: Staging env misconfigured for Siftgate bloom filter

The bloom layer in front of the Pellet KV store is rejecting all lookups in staging because the env file was copied from the dev template without credentials. False-positive tuning values are fine; only the auth line is missing. To unblock the weekly demo, the Pellet admission secret must be set on the following line.

env line for yaguf-fajop: LEDGER_TOKEN13=fb08984397349

Subject: Key rotation for InvoiceForge renderer

Welcome, new folks. Every quarter we rotate the credential the Pellworth PDF invoice renderer uses to call our internal asset service, Vaultline. The old key stops working Friday at noon. Update your local .env and the staging config before then, and verify a test invoice renders with the new embedded fonts. For convenience, the freshly issued key is included here.

app token of bagef-bageg = kto11_vuwA0uhrEMg